The cohesive force in the. Radio program was Wayne J. Pond, director of public programs at the National Humanities Center. As the program’s sole producer and interviewer, he created a state-of-the-art recording studio in a small study at the National Humanities Center, where he also promoted and found sponsorship for the program with the aid of a small staff. From 1980 to 1997, the National Humanities Center produced the popular weekly radio show. Now, through a partnership with the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ill Libraries and RENCI (Renaissance Computing Institute), the National Humanities Center is once again able to share.
